Search Engine Marketing Professional Organization (SEMPO) Chairman and Board Members are touring Asia through 9-15 June, 09 to foster awareness, educate, and promote the search industry in Asia.
The India visit is on 15 June 09. The event would consist of a Workshop and a Roundtable for Digital Agencies & companies having a Digital Marketing Division. The event will bring together leading global and Indian practitioners from the Search Marketing discipline on a single platform. The event is an opportunity to:
• Gain insights on Enterprise SEO for large business ventures
• Learn how Global PPC Campaigns & SEM strategies accelerate growth businesses
• Discover the impact SEO, SEM & SMO can have in increasing the reach of businesses
Convonix is proud to sponsor the ‘Search Engine Marketing Roundtable’ Event in Mumbai on Monday, June 15th 2009.

Keywords research and analysis is undoubtedly the foundation of an SEO campaign. Every single strategy and all the modifications we would perform as an effort towards search engine optimization is a derivative and is dependent on the keywords you narrow down upon.
As SEO professionals, we rely heavily on Keyword Research tools and Web Analytics tools in order to discover core keyword phrases, which are commonly used across all of the commercial web search engines. Though we look at a number of factors and user search statistics during this analysis such as the competition, search volumes; there is an entire facet of reason we tend to ignore. This is – the connection between User Search Trends and Usability.
In a purer sense of the term usability means a users reaction to any website. Yes, a positive experience would include ease of use, appeal of the interface etc. but by far Relevancy is the most important factor to consider.
Keyword research tools reveal search behaviors based on which we would rebuild a site’s information architecture. We can also tailor ads and landing pages for Pay per Click marketing to searchers who typically use a single, targeted search engine. But does our web analytics data validate our keyword research? Is the particular keyword phrase appropriate for that type of website? Are we reaching our correct target audience?
As an astute SEO Company we realize that our work is not an exact science, but a combination of keyword research tools, statistical knowledge and intuitive judgment. We should understand when it is appropriate to implement keywords into a site’s information architecture with the perspective of the user as well. We do monitor the effectiveness of keyword-driven traffic via web analytics data. But without the correct user perspective of the target audience Keyword research data and Web analytics search data can be easily misinterpreted.
“Stickiness” is a metric that which can be measured by the number of page views per visitor via search engine traffic and the average time on site. Stickiness of the keyword along with the current global search trends (on a time relative graph) are effective parameters to be used in periodic iterations of Keyword Analyses.
In conclusion the most important aspect of an SEO campaign, the Keyword Research and Analysis, should be carried out with a good balance of the science (the data) and art (the intuition) that is SEO.
